Bangalore: On Sunday, the Union Minister of Finance and Trade laid the groundwork for a new construction of the Income Tax Department in Bangalore.

He also unveiled the plaque of the first stone of the site. According to the press release, the new construction will feature an exclusive public relations workplace and a waiting room for taxpayers. taxpayer.

The next construction of the Income Tax Department has G 18 floors and parking in the basement.

The construction has been designed to make the most of the herbs and complies with the GRIHA IV standard.

It also has solar panels for the generation of electrical energy and a rainwater harvesting system. The recycled water will be used for gardening and a plumbing system.

The central air purification formula is supplied with magnetic cleaning and UV sterilization. Construction will be done through Bangalore Project Circle, CPWD.
